我有一个VM在80端口上运行一个节点js服务器。它运行得很好。现在我在VM上本地运行另一个nodejs服务器,端口为3000.它在VM上本地运行以及80端口。 所以,
localhost:80
localhost:3000
像魅力一样工作。问题是,例如http://zubair.cloudapp.net的实时URL只运行80端口,我应该如何使用此URL运行3000端口服务器?我想到了这样的事情: http://zubair.cloudapp.net:3000但它没有用。
注意:我还在端点中添加了3000端口,但未在图片中显示,但仍然没有工作。任何帮助,将不胜感激。感谢
答案 0 :(得分:1)
看起来像Windows VM。您是否在操作系统防火墙中添加了3000 / TCP入站规则?
您需要端点定义和 3000 / TCP (入站)的Windows防火墙规则才能使其正常工作。